      7-(2-thienyl)-imidazo[4,5-b]pyridine (Ds) is an unnatural nucleic acid which forms stable pair with Pyrrole-2-carbaldehyde (Pa) in DNA. This Ds-Pa pair gets stabilized via van der Waals interaction and shape fitting. In our previous study,\cite{ghosh2021radiationless} we investigated the non-radiative photo-processes of unnatural DNA base Pa and also there are some studies on its stability and reactivity in the ground state. But to form a good unnatural base pair, one has to understand its stability not only in the ground state but also in the excited states after absorbing UV radiation. Therefore, in this study, the excited state photo-processes of Ds on UV irradiation and it's non-radiative decay channels have been investigated. It is shown using state of the art multi reference methods and this investigation finally leads the molecule to access minimum energy crossing point (MECP) via a downhill pathway.
